How To Install

Just download and use the run_peppertux_portable.bat file to run the game in a portable way. I don't know what SuperTux does there but you avoid save file issues with this method.

If you found any issues, report the issues to the GitHub Issues page for this repository, or the comments of the GameJolt page of PepperTux.


Story

The same story as SuperTux, basically, Tux goes to a picnic with Penny, but Nolok attacks and captures Penny, leaving just a note telling Tux that he doesn't stand a chance at getting Penny back, so Tux goes forward to Nolok's Icy Island castle, hoping that Nolok and Penny would be there.


The Purpose Of This

PepperTux is meant to be like SuperTux 0.6.3 with some 0.7.0 things. It's a mod for SuperTux 0.7.0

There's really no purpose, just here for fun.

This isn't meant to be "finished SuperTux before SuperTux Team does it", although it is kind of that (to be honest, by the time Tropical Island or Snow Mountain is finished in this, SuperTux will likely already have one or two of those (Tropical Paradise / Mountain Peaks)), it's meant to be a fun little "what if" question, like what if old SuperTux had the new worlds and even a Desert world? (Secret Desert, as it's a secret world)

Also, the worldmaps are different now.

The levels are also replaced with new ones.

Source Code

This is a mod of SuperTux v0.7.0 that edits the source code... or at least it will at some point, just not really now since there's no need to. Yes, sector_parser and various badguys have sprite files changed, but that's not really that noticeable in-game.
